Analysis

Romania recorded 51.8% for overcrowding rate by tenure status - total population in 2025.

The figure is down 11.3% on the previous year and up 38.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, overcrowding rate by tenure status - total population in Romania peaked at 70.0% in 2007 and was at its lowest, 29.0%, in 2016.

That places Romania 4th out of 38 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 19 years of available data.
